Linux实战:构建与优化个人高效开发环境指南
在Linux环境下进行开发,构建一个高效的工作环境是提升生产力的关键。选择合适的发行版是第一步,常见的如Ubuntu、Debian、Fedora等,各有其特点,可以根据个人需求和项目要求进行选择。 图示AI提供,仅供参考 安装必要的开发工具链是基础操作,包括编译器(如GCC)、版本控制工具(如Git)以及文本编辑器或集成开发环境(如VS Code、Vim)。这些工具能够显著提高代码编写与调试的效率。 配置环境变量和路径设置可以优化命令行使用体验。通过修改~/.bashrc或~/.zshrc文件,添加常用命令的别名和路径,让日常操作更加便捷。 使用包管理器可以简化软件安装与维护过程。例如,APT(Debian/Ubuntu)和YUM/DNF(Fedora/RHEL)提供了丰富的软件仓库,确保系统保持最新且安全。 合理利用脚本自动化重复任务,如构建、测试和部署流程,能大幅提升工作效率。Shell脚本或Python脚本是实现自动化的常见方式。 定期更新系统和软件包有助于防止安全漏洞,同时确保性能优化和新功能的可用性。建议设置自动更新策略或定期手动检查更新。 掌握基本的系统监控和日志分析技能,有助于快速定位和解决问题,保障开发环境的稳定运行。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|